On June 16, 2025, the IEEE IMS Summer School 2025 took place at the Telecommunications Research Institute of ISCTE University in Lisbon, Portugal, under the theme "Smart Systems for Ambient Assisted Living (AAL)", focusing on digital solutions for active aging and remote healthcare.

Representing Al-Farabi Kazakh National University, the following speakers delivered presentations:

  • Madina Mansurova, Head of the Department of Artificial Intelligence and Big Data, presented on the role of AI and big data analytics in transforming healthcare and preparing human capital for the digital economy;

  • Talshyn Sarsembayeva, Deputy Head for Research and Innovation, shared KazNU’s practices in implementing interdisciplinary educational programs and integrating digital solutions into the learning process.

The delegation also included five master's students from the Business Analytics and Big Data educational program, as well as junior research staff actively engaged in the discussion of projects and solutions in the field of Ambient Assisted Living (AAL).

The event gathered participants from universities and research institutes across Europe and Central Asia. The discussions focused on:

  • demographic aging and healthcare system challenges;

  • digital and sensor technologies for monitoring health and living environments;

  • rehabilitation using smart crutches and walkers, virtual and mixed reality, wearable devices, infrared thermography, and the use of AI and IoT in medicine.

Participation in the international summer school enabled the department to present KazNU’s experience in digital technologies and education, establish academic collaboration with European peers, and involve students in cutting-edge scientific discussions.
